Benjamin "Ben" Maccar of Burlington, passed away at the Masonic Village in Burlington Township on Tuesday at the age of 93. Born in Philadelphia, Ben worked for and retired after 30 years as a Supervisor from Hoeganes in Cinnaminson. Ben was devout Catholic who was a parishioner of St. Paul's RC Church in Burlington. He was lifelong member of Moose Lodge, enjoyed bowling and playing Bingo. Ben was predeceased by his wife Betty, his sisters Kate, Rose and Frances. He is survived, his children: Anthony (Diane), David (Antoinette), Michael (Christina); 6 granchildren; 4 great-grandchildren; sister Rita, a dear special friend, Florence Perro Morrison and many nieces, nephews and cousins.
